1. SSD (Solid State Drive) Overview

SSD is an innovative information storage medium that boasts superior performance 
and higher reliability than conventional HDDs (Hard Disk Drive). SSDs provide very fast 
PC booting, application loading speed, and perform exceptionally well in multi-tasking 
environments. SSDs also have several great features such as very low power consumption, 
extremely low heat emission, no-noise, and outstanding stability compared to conventional 
HDDs. Please visit www.samsung.com/SSD for more information on SSDs.

2. Precautions

Handling Precautions

Injury or product damage may occur if the following guidelines are not followed.

1.  Shock

SSDs are built stronger against shock or vibration and can protect data with greater 
safety than conventional HDDs. However, please protect the product against severe 
shock. Excessive Shock may damage components in SSD and may also cause hardware 
detection failures or operational failures when installed in your PC. In addition, severe 
shock may open or break the SSD cover.

2.  Short Circuit

Please keep metal objects out of the SATA Interface circuit. SSD circuits may be shorted 
if the SATA interface is contacted by metal objects or electrical shock. This may cause 
hardware detection failures or operational failures.

3.  Disassemble/Damage/Removal

Please do not disassemble the SSD, damage the SSD or remove the sticker or the label 
affixed on the product. Any product that has the case opened, or has a damaged or 
removed label on the back of the product shall not be covered by the warranty.
